Golden Globes
Commonly known as Golden Globes, this is an herbaceous perennial (almost shrub) grown for its bright flowers and lovely foliage. It produces lush, mid-green leaves which are held densely off short stems. The foliage is adorned with golden flowers borne through summer. It typically grows to 10 cm tall and 25 cm wide, performing best grown in full sun on a well-drained, sheltered site. It is tolerant of cool climates and moderate frost and in these environments may die back to regrow again when conditions warm. Golden Globes is commonly included in a mixed or border planting, included in cottage gardens, planted around outdoor living areas, or maintained in a container.
